Windows Activation Technologies (WAT) is Microsoft's system for identifying whether a Windows installation is properly licensed. When you install Windows without activation, you typically get a 30-day grace period. After that period expires, Windows displays persistent notifications, a watermark on your desktop, and gradually restricts certain features.
